For the exhibition Modifikation—stetig steigende Steine (Modification—Constantly Climbing Stones) at the Kunstverein Ruhr in Essen, Germany, two pillars in the gallery space were walled in with differently shaped bricks manufactured specifically for this purpose. The multiple consists of one brick each from the two bonds.
